The station boasts comprehensive facilities for ticket buying and collection. It's equipped with a ticket office open from early morning till late evening on weekdays, and slightly adjusted hours over the weekend,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ets at your convenience. For tech-savvy travelers, smartcards can be issued and validated here, offering a seamless travel experience. Accessible ticket machines are located in the booking hall, ensuring ease of use for all.
Security and assistance are well-planned, with CCTV operational throughout the station and a Secure Station accreditation. Staff are on hand to provide help and support, available every day of the week—with extended hours from early morning to late night. Beckenham Junction understands the importance of accessibility, offering step-free access to multiple platforms, though more detailed inquiries might be necessary for specific route planning.
Continue your journey efficiently with a variety of transport links available. There is a dedicated taxi service located right in front of the station, ensuring easy access for a quick getaway. For those reaching further afield, the station accommodates rail replacement services right from the station forecourt at bus stop A (ozone.else.tricks) as well as a range of local bus services.
For avid cyclists, there's provision for bicycle storage with stands and sheltered areas, though it's recommended to bring your own lock since the station doesn't provide CCTV for this area. Additionally, with the emerging trend of cycling as a commute option, note that there are no cycle hire facilities, so plan accordingly before arriving.

Nestled in the charming seaside town of Felixstowe, the train station is a gateway for both locals and visitors. Known for its proximity to one of the busiest container ports in Europe, Felixstowe presents a blend of maritime industry and beachside tourism. While the town is bustling with activity, the train station offers a straightforward and seamless travel experience for those venturing into the heart of Suffolk and beyond.
At Felixstowe train station, travelers will find ticket machines readily available to purchase and collect pre-bought tickets. These machines are accessible to everyone, including those with mobility challenges, thanks to the station's step-free access and the provision of induction loops. The station prides itself on being user-friendly, even without a staffed ticket office.
While there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ities at the station, passengers can utilize the seating area on the platform. The station is well-equipped with CCTV for added security, and help points ensure assistance is always within reach. Although luggage storage and cycle hire options are not available, the station does provide substantial bicycle storage, making it convenient for cycling enthusiasts and commuters alike.
Felixstowe station enjoys good connectivity with local transport options. Even in the event of rail disruptions, a rail replacement bus service ensures minimal inconvenience by picking up passengers right outside the station's entrance. Although there are no accessible taxis or car hire services directly at the station, Felixstowe's central location makes it easy to arrange onward travel within town or further afield.
